首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将数据从一个html页面传递到另一个html页面?

在前端开发中,可以通过以下几种方式将数据从一个HTML页面传递到另一个HTML页面:

  1. URL参数传递:可以通过在URL中添加查询参数的方式将数据传递给另一个HTML页面。例如,可以在链接中添加类似于?key1=value1&key2=value2的参数,然后在目标页面中通过解析URL参数来获取传递的数据。在目标页面的JavaScript代码中,可以使用URLSearchParams对象或手动解析location.search来获取URL参数的值。
  2. 表单提交:如果数据需要通过用户输入或选择来获取,可以使用表单提交的方式将数据传递给另一个HTML页面。在源页面的表单中,可以使用<form>元素和各种表单控件(如<input><select><textarea>等)来收集数据,并设置表单的action属性为目标页面的URL。在目标页面中,可以使用后端技术(如PHP、Node.js等)来处理表单提交的数据。
  3. Web存储:可以使用Web存储技术(如localStoragesessionStorage)将数据存储在浏览器中,然后在另一个HTML页面中读取这些数据。在源页面的JavaScript代码中,可以使用localStorage.setItem(key, value)方法将数据存储到本地存储中,然后在目标页面的JavaScript代码中使用localStorage.getItem(key)方法来获取存储的数据。
  4. Cookie:可以使用Cookie将数据传递给另一个HTML页面。在源页面的JavaScript代码中,可以使用document.cookie属性来设置Cookie的值,然后在目标页面的JavaScript代码中使用document.cookie属性来获取Cookie的值。

需要注意的是,以上方法都是在前端进行数据传递,如果需要将数据传递给后端进行处理,还需要使用后端技术来接收和处理数据。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云COS(对象存储):腾讯云对象存储(Cloud Object Storage,COS)是一种存储海量文件的分布式存储服务,提供了安全、稳定、低成本、高可扩展的云端存储解决方案。
  • 腾讯云API网关:腾讯云API网关是一种全托管的API服务,可帮助开发者轻松构建、发布、运维、监控和安全保护API,提供高性能、高可用、高扩展性的API访问服务。
  • 腾讯云云函数(SCF):腾讯云云函数(Serverless Cloud Function,SCF)是一种事件驱动的无服务器计算服务,可帮助开发者在云端运行代码,无需关心服务器管理和运维,实现按需计费和弹性扩缩容。
  • 腾讯云CDN:腾讯云内容分发网络(Content Delivery Network,CDN)是一种分布式部署的加速网络,通过将内容缓存到离用户更近的节点,提供快速、稳定的内容分发服务,加速网站访问和下载速度。

请注意,以上仅为腾讯云的一些相关产品,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

18分9秒

120_尚硅谷_以太坊项目二_去中心化eBay_web前端基本功能(三)主页面HTML设置

25分21秒

121_尚硅谷_以太坊项目二_去中心化eBay_web前端基本功能(四)上架商品页面HTML

50秒

可视化中国特色新基建

领券